CEVA and DARPA partner for technology innovation
CEVA has announced an open licensing agreement with the US Defense Advanced Research Projects Agency (DARPA) to accelerate technology innovation for DARPA programs. The partnership, as part of the DARPA Toolbox initiative, establishes an access framework under which DARPA organisations can access all of CEVA’s commercially available IPs, tools and support to expedite their programs.

Molex acquires Fiberguide Industries
Molex has announced the acquisition of Fiberguide Industries, a manufacturer of customised optical fibre solutions based in Caldwell, Idaho. Fiberguide will join Molex’s Polymicro business, a Phoenix-based provider of specialty optical fibre and fluidic-based products tailored for medical, industrial and datacom applications.
CPI renews ISO certification for medical devices
CPI has today announced the successful re-audit and renewal of its ISO certification 13485:2016 – the international standard for medical device Quality Management Systems (QMS). Compliance with ISO 13485 is a key part of meeting global regulatory requirements and allows CPI to continue offering an accelerated route to market for developers of medical devices.
CES 2021 Innovation Awards Honouree from Infineon
Infineon Technologies smart entrance counter solution has been named a CES 2021 Innovation Awards Honoree in the ‘Smart Cities’ category. The solution enables accurate, anonymous and contactless people counting using a single XENSIV 60GHz radar and integrated software. A traffic light system informs whether entry to the location is allowed.
